To understand the role of the Industrial Engineer, one must first appreciate the distinct industrial ecosystem of China Guangzhou. Historically known as a trade port and a manufacturing powerhouse for textiles, toys, and electronics, Guangzhou has strategically pivoted toward advanced industries. The city is home to numerous multinational corporations and domestic tech giants alike.

The infrastructure in China Guangzhou is world-class, featuring one of the busiest ports globally (Nansha Port) and extensive high-speed rail networks connecting it to Shenzhen, Hong Kong, and beyond. This logistical density creates a perfect testing ground for Industrial Engineering solutions focused on supply chain resilience and just-in-time production. However, it also introduces complexities related to labor dynamics, environmental regulations, and the integration of legacy systems with cutting-edge technology.

3.1 Integration of Industry 4.0 Technologies

The adoption of Internet of Things (IoT), Artificial Intelligence (AI), and Big Data analytics is accelerating in Guangzhou’s manufacturing parks. The Industrial Engineer acts as the bridge between these digital tools and physical operations. For instance, when implementing smart factory initiatives, the IE is responsible for determining which data points are critical for real-time decision-making. In China Guangzhou, where competition drives rapid iteration speeds, the ability to leverage predictive maintenance and automated quality inspection systems is paramount.

3.2 Supply Chain Resilience and Logistics

Given its status as a logistics hub, supply chain optimization is a primary focus for Industrial Engineers in this region. The complexity of global trade routes originating from China Guangzhou requires robust risk management strategies. IEs are tasked with designing resilient networks that can withstand disruptions, whether caused by geopolitical tensions or public health crises. This involves optimizing inventory levels across multiple tiers of suppliers and distributors, ensuring that the flow of goods remains uninterrupted while minimizing holding costs.

Despite its advantages, operating an Industrial Engineering function in China Guangzhou presents specific hurdles. One significant challenge is the rapid pace of technological change. Professionals must engage in continuous learning to stay relevant with emerging technologies such as digital twins and autonomous mobile robots (AMRs).

Furthermore, there is a growing emphasis on sustainability and green manufacturing. The Chinese government’s "Dual Carbon" goals require Industrial Engineers to redesign processes that reduce energy consumption and carbon footprints. In China Guangzhou, this means integrating eco-friendly practices into existing production lines without compromising efficiency or cost-effectiveness.

Another challenge is the talent gap. While there is a large workforce, there is often a mismatch between academic training and the practical skills needed for advanced Industrial Engineering roles. Companies in Guangzhou are increasingly investing in internal training programs to upskill their engineers in data science and cross-functional communication.
